Transaction 29c08220b67424244a133f9952932bf2582c6137261ecb0deb8e014150cd7b22
1 Input
2 Outputs
- 29c08220b67424244a133f9952932bf2582c6137261ecb0deb8e014150cd7b22:0
- 29c08220b67424244a133f9952932bf2582c6137261ecb0deb8e014150cd7b22:1
value 883142
address 178mHAsM9Lf3hts3nZPG1n3nZhfpFjQP9r
value 118489
address 3D4StVCPe5KWW5fdMNDDExjexgEWNJQLdX